It's called the Shoebox method. Get a shoebox, cut a rectangular slot in the top. Now tape the box securely closed and write the date on it. Some people find it helpful to coincide starting this on payday or at the beginning of the month. Decide what start date works best for you. Once you decide though, be faithful and stick to the plan. It takes one month.
To start, pick your date. Now be sure to get a receipt for everything you spend money on, no matter how small of an expense it is. Include cigarettes, coffee (lattes), candy bars, nights out on the town, EVERYTHING! Every penny you spend, be sure to get a receipt if possible. Put all these receipts in the shoebox. If you pay your children allowance or have other expenditures that may not generate a receipt, quickly make one and stuff it in the box. Be sure to put a copy of your bills in there too.
Ok, it's been one month and you have been very good about gathering all your receipts and expenses, putting them in the box. Open the box and get a tablet to write on. Anything that is a repeated expense, be sure to write down under the same heading. Adding everything up, you can quickly see where the money really goes. Be sure to multiply those figures by 12 to see how much is spent a year!
This should allow you to see exactly where you can make some cuts by giving you a great overview of your expenditures. Don't wait to do this, get started today!
